Frank PERRY Obituary



PERRY, Frank Leslie
Died peacefully at Rouge Valley Centenary Hospital on Friday, September 25th, 2009 at the age of 84, with family by his side. Born April 22, 1925 in Toronto to the late Millicent May Annie Holdway & Edwin Thomas John Perry, Frank enjoyed a distinguished career as an actor and narrator that spanned over 60 years, including Summer Stock Theatre in Peterborough, CBC Radio & Television Drama, Recordings, Commercial Voice-Over & numerous character roles in Canadian Television Series & Films. He is survived by sons David & Michael, their wives Kano & Gloria, granddaughter Noa, brother Cliff & his wife Dorothy, sister Joan, nephews Jim, Bob, Bruce, Brian & nieces Judy, Jill & Wendy.
